Look Magazine – October 22, 1940 – Mr. and Mrs. Wendell Willkie Cover (No Label, VG Condition)
This vintage issue of Look Magazine, dated October 22, 1940, features presidential candidate Wendell Willkie and his wife on the cover, offering a personal look at the Republican challenger just weeks before the 1940 U.S. presidential election. Willkie, a corporate lawyer and political newcomer, rose to national prominence during this period as he faced off against Franklin D. Roosevelt's historic third-term campaign.
A notable feature in this issue includes a Q&A-style article with President Roosevelt, addressing key topics such as:
-
U.S. rearmament capabilities in the face of global conflict
-
Concerns about the return of price controls and economic regulation
-
Federal policy on business pressures and industry support
-
The role of the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C)
-
Agricultural policy and continuation of New Deal-era farm programs
The article is supported by striking photographs of wartime production—shipbuilding, armament factories, infrastructure development, and scenes of Roosevelt with his advisors—capturing the state of the nation during a critical moment in American history.
